How to Get Cases in CS:GO

There are a variety of ways to get cases for csgo. One option is to purchase cases on the Steam market which is a marketplace created by Valve Corporation.

Another way is to open the cases following the match. This can be done in any of the game modes including Casual, Deathmatch and Competitive. You can open cases even if are playing on community servers.

1. Play the game

CSGO, a popular online game that allows players to win attractive gear, is a very popular game. The best method to earn cases is to play the game each week and earn the cases. The Steam market is another option, but it is costly. As an added bonus, completing Operation Missions can result in the creation of a case.

A CSGO case is a container that gives players the opportunity to get an unspecified skin. Each player is entitled to receive two CSGO case every week. These cases could be safe, graffiti or skins for weapons. The chances of obtaining cases are greater when playing in Deathmatch mode. Cases are available to players who have completed Casual, War Games or Wingman matches. The chances of receiving cases are less when you play games that are competitive.

To open the file, players require an access code. This can be purchased by purchasing one on the Steam marketplace or through trading with other players. Keys aren't transferable, and can only by used by their owner. It was previously possible to trade CSGO cases and keys with other players, but this option was blocked in the year 2019.

There are a variety of CSGO cases, including Revolution Case, Recoil Case, Dreams and Nightmares Case, and Fracture Case. Each type of case has distinct colors and comes with weapons that are priced differently. Blue skins are known as Mil-Spec and are the most affordable skins, whereas pink and purple skins are more expensive. Red skins are most sought-after and can be worth a lot of money.

Another method to acquire cases is by playing the game. Cases can be acquired at the end of every match, whether in competitive or casual matchmaking mode. They can also earn them by completing an Operation mission when there's one player active in the game. This method is not 100% guaranteed and is entirely based on chance.


The game itself is the best method of obtaining csgo cases. Each player is entitled to two cases each week, regardless of how many games they have played. The cases are randomly distributed following a match and are not based on a player's performance in the game. This means that both the best and worst players can get them. The drop counter for each item is reset at the end of each week.
